An unoptimized, or "verbose," Gcode file, often directly exported from CAM software without refinement, contains inefficient toolpaths, redundant commands, and nonoptimal cutting parameters. This leads to a cascade of negative outcomes: prolonged cycle times, excessive tool wear, poor surface finishes, and heightened energy consumption. Essentially, you are paying more in machine time, tooling, and electricity for a slower and potentially inferior result.
Strategic Gcode optimization directly addresses these inefficiencies. This process involves:
Toolpath Optimization: Creating the most efficient route for the tool to follow, minimizing rapid, noncutting movements and ensuring smooth, continuous motion. This significantly reduces cycle times.
Parameter Tuning: Precisely adjusting feed rates and spindle speeds for different sections of the operation. This protects the tool from undue stress, extends its lifespan, and ensures optimal chip load for a better surface finish.
Reducing Redundancy: Eliminating unnecessary commands and streamlining the code, which leads to smoother machine execution and less computational lag.
